Folks, A vulnerability has been reported in PLA 1.1.0.5, and probably affects all PLA 1.1 versions. Details of the vulnerability are here:
http://www.exploit-db.com/exploits/10410 http://secunia.com/advisories/37848/ I'm not able to reproduce it on PLA 1.2, however, if somebody can, please let me know how and I'll release a fix as soon as I find out.
